Kurt Vile: <i>So Outta Reach</i>

“When your ax is acting up/ Throw some delay on it, turn it up,” Vile sings on this six-song EP’s almost-title track, “(so outta reach).” Not bad advice, really. Especially for someone like Vile, whose music has a muzzy, lived-in feel whether he’s layering vintage synthesizers in his bedroom or recording acoustic guitars in the studio with John Agnello, as he did on his most recent full-length for Matador, Smoke Ring for My Halo.   read more

Kurt Vile to Release New EP So Outta Reach

Kurt Vile to Release New EP <i>So Outta Reach</i>

This morning Matador Records announced via their blog that low-fi rocker Kurt Vile will be releasing a new six-song EP, comprised mostly of unused tracks recorded during the sessions for Vile's Smoke Ring For My Halo, which released march of this year. In addition to the session tracks, So Outta Reach includes a cover of Bruce Springsteen's 1984 song "Downbound Train".  read more
